Her award-winning play "The Mountaintop" enjoyed a successful run on Broadway 3 years ago, after an even more enthusiastic response from audiences in London where it premiered. The fictional depiction of the Reverend Martin Luther King Jr's last night, on the eve of his assassination on April 4, 1968, starred Samuel L. Jackson and Angela Bassett when it debuted on Broadway, and went on to tour around the country through 2013. Now playwright Katori Hall is set to make the transition from stage to screen, and not just as a writer, but a director as well.  I've learned that Hall will make her feature film directorial debut with an adaptation of her own...
